Why conduct a Criminal Records Search?
- Employers may want to obtain this information before hiring an applicant. Knowing if a potential employee has a criminal past can help them determine whether or not he or she is qualified and truthful enough to be hired. It also helps reduce turnover, ensures quality customer relations, and maintains a safe working environment for everyone.
- Landlords may want to know if their tenant is suitable for their property. Conducting a Criminal Records Search reduces your exposure to risks associated with new tenants.
- Some people may have a gut feeling that someone they are associated with has a criminal past. Conducting a Criminal Records Search can help to protect you and/or your family from any potential danger.
